Princeton's WordNet

  1. quarantinenoun

    enforced isolation of patients suffering from a contagious disease in order to prevent the spread of disease

  2. quarantineverb

    isolation to prevent the spread of infectious disease

  3. quarantineverb

    place into enforced isolation, as for medical reasons

    "My dog was quarantined before he could live in England"
